存储在云端?
用户选择的背景图像可以通过以下步骤持久存储在云端:
- 上传图像:用户选择的背景图像可以通过前端开发技术,例如HTML5的文件上传功能或者JavaScript的File API,将图像文件上传至后端服务器。
- 后端存储:后端开发工程师可以使用后端开发语言(如Java、Python、Node.js等)和数据库技术(如MySQL、MongoDB等)将用户上传的图像存储在云端。可以将图像文件直接存储在服务器的文件系统中,或者将图像以二进制数据的形式存储在数据库中。
- 云存储服务:为了更好地管理和存储用户的背景图像,可以使用云存储服务。腾讯云提供了对象存储服务(COS),可以将用户上传的图像存储在COS中。COS具有高可靠性、高可用性和高扩展性,可以根据实际需求选择存储桶的地域和存储类型。
- 存储桶设置:在腾讯云COS中,可以创建一个存储桶,并设置相关的权限和访问控制策略。可以通过腾讯云控制台或者API进行配置,确保只有经过授权的用户可以访问和下载存储在云端的背景图像。
- 图像访问:为了让用户能够访问和使用存储在云端的背景图像,可以通过生成一个访问链接或者提供一个API接口。用户可以通过访问链接或者调用API来获取背景图像的URL,然后在前端应用中使用该URL来加载和显示图像。
总结起来,用户选择的背景图像可以通过前端上传至后端服务器,后端开发工程师将图像存储在云存储服务中,例如腾讯云的对象存储服务(COS)。通过设置存储桶的权限和访问控制策略,确保只有经过授权的用户可以访问和下载图像。最后,通过生成访问链接或者提供API接口,用户可以获取背景图像的URL,用于在前端应用中加载和显示图像。
腾讯云对象存储服务(COS)产品介绍链接:https://cloud.tencent.com/product/cos